What is Educational Building Blocks?
Educational Building Blocks operates as a comprehensive childcare and early education provider, catering to children from infancy through age twelve. The company distinguishes itself through a rigorous adherence to the Pennsylvania Early Learning Standards and the Keystone STARS quality improvement system. By integrating academic assistance aligned with state-mandated educational benchmarks, the firm bridges the gap between traditional daycare and formal schooling. Its facility, fully licensed by the Pennsylvania Department of Human Services, serves as a critical hub for social, emotional, and intellectual development, offering specialized programs such as summer camps and before-and-after school transportation to local school districts.
